    Engineer battalion welcomes new top enlisted man

    WOODLAWN, Ohio - The Ohio National Guard’s Woodlawn-based 216th Engineer Battalion recently welcomed a new top enlisted man, Sgt. Maj. Steven Shepherd.

    Shepherd, from Gahanna, has served in the Army for over 21 years. In his military career, he has spent seven years in the active duty Army and the remainder of his time with the Ohio National Guard. Shepherd has been stationed primarily within the 2nd Battalion, 107th Cavalry. Shepherd has also spent time with the 37th Infantry Brigade Combat Team in Columbus, Ohio, as the Reconnaissance Operations sergeant major before coming to the 216th Engineer Battalion.

    Shepherd joined the military right out of high school. He graduated from Lebanon High School in Warren County in 1983. Being away from the home with the military has not prevented Shepherd from pursuing additional education. He has not only gone through numerous military schools, but he has also been pursuing a bachelor’s degree in business management.

    During Shepherd’s time with the military, he has traveled all over the world including being stationed in Alaska, Germany and Kentucky. He has also been deployed to Kosovo, to the Gulf Coast in support of Hurricane relief efforts, as well as in support of Operation Iraqi Freedom and Operation Noble Eagle.

    Shepherd is unique in the fact that he is not a full-time soldier. As a civilian, he works for the Limited Brands as a loss prevention security manager. He and his wife are also franchise owners of Smoothie King in Gahanna.

    Shepherd is extremely decorated soldier. In the course of his military career, he has been awarded a Bronze Star, numerous Army Commendation and Achievement Medals. He has also been awarded an Air Assault Badge, a combat patch, the Order of Saint George, and the Order of the Combat Spurs to name a few of the many awards that he has received.

    “I want this battalion to be the number one battalion in the state,” said Shepherd. “To achieve this, I believe that I and my follow senior enlisted soldiers need to help foster a command climate that makes soldiers want to stay in the National Guard.”

    Shepherd said to accomplish this, two things need to happen. “I believe that we need to have our families behind us and be able to communicate our missions to them. Our family is our biggest supporter, if they are not behind us, the mission may not be as successful.”

    “The other thing is that I want to train soldiers,” said Shepherd. “I believe that it is better to train soldiers and to keep training them. I think it is better to over train than to under train. This way, in a very stressful situation, the soldier is able to rely on their training. This will give them a better chance of getting through the situation intact and be able to get home to their loved ones.”

    Shepherd has been married for 10 years and has a daughter who graduated from the University of Cincinnati. In his free time, Shepherd enjoys spending time with his family and working on old cars.
